RAG Agent with ChromaDB and Tavily
Overview
This repository implements a RAG (Retrieval‑Augmented Generation) agent that can answer questions by searching a local knowledge base stored in ChromaDB or by fetching up‑to‑date information from the web using Tavily. The agent automatically chooses the most appropriate source based on the query and returns the answer together with the source identifier.
Features
- Local Knowledge Base – Vector store backed by ChromaDB with embeddings from Ollama (
nomic-embed-text). - Web Search – Uses Tavily API for real‑time web queries.
- Automatic Routing – The agent decides whether to use the local KB or the web search.
- CLI – Simple command‑line interface for interactive queries.
- Persistence – The ChromaDB store is persisted between runs.
Setup
-
Install Ollama and pull the required models:
ollama pull llama3 ollama pull nomic-embed-text -
Install Python dependencies:
pip install -r requirements.txt -
Set up the Tavily API key. Create a
.envfile in the project root with:TAVILY_API_KEY=your_api_key_here -
Add documents you want to index into the
documents/folder. The script will automatically load.txtand.mdfiles.

Project Structure
vectorstore.py– Helper functions for creating and populating the ChromaDB vector store.agent.py– Defines the tools and initializes the LangChain agent.main.py– CLI entry point.requirements.txt– Python dependencies.README.md– Documentation.
Notes
- The agent uses the Zero‑Shot React strategy. It may call both tools if the query is ambiguous. You can tweak the prompt or the routing logic if needed.
- The ChromaDB store is persisted in
./chroma_db. Delete this folder to re‑index. - Ensure the Ollama server is running locally when executing the agent.
